How to clear your website cache.

Go to your GoDaddy product page. Next to Website Security and Backups, select Manage All. Under Firewall, select Details. Under Performance, select Clear Cache. Once the cache has been cleared a message will appear in the upper-right corner: Your request to purge the cache has been submitted. Please allow up to 30 seconds for the …

Clearing your site’s cache can lead to degraded performance and slower loading times for you and your visitors while the cache is rebuilt. To avoid a performance drop, the server-side cache should be only cleared in rare circumstances. It is not a tool for optimizing your site’s speed. Cached images and files.Browser caching is slightly different than server caching in that there aren’t as many files stored in the browser. Images, favicons, content, and CSS files will likely be stored in a browser’s cache. All the rest, however, would need to be handled by the server. But the process is the same.

Also, cache files can grow very large, taking up space on your Mac and slowing down the web browser. If you find that web pages aren’t loading properly or are not displaying the most recent information, clearing the cache is a good solution. It will fix the problem with minimal inconvenience.
